Why temporary numbers matter for modern business

Businesses require verification channels that are both fast and secure. Temporary numbers—also known as disposable or short-term virtual numbers—serve as a controlled surface for user verification, onboarding, and risk screening. They reduce the risk of SIM swapping, phone-number fatigue, and data leakage while maintaining a clean, auditable trail for compliance. For many teams, this translates into shorter cycle times, higher completion rates, and improved customer experience.

From regional operations in Vietnam to global programs that involve airlines, marketplaces, and digital goods platforms, a scalable pool of temporary numbers is essential. The right numbers can adapt to regional regulations, different carrier environments, and diverse messaging patterns. When you combine instant provisioning with intelligent routing, you gain a predictable, auditable, and compliant verification funnel.

Precautions

While instant access to temporary numbers unlocks significant business value, it also requires careful governance to prevent abuse, protect user privacy, and comply with applicable laws. The following precautions help maintain a secure, compliant, and high-performing verification environment.

  • Data minimization: Only collect and retain information strictly necessary for the verification task. Use per-transaction identifiers instead of long-term personal identifiers when possible.
  • TTL and scope controls: Enforce strict TTLs and scope limits for each number to prevent leakage and unauthorized reuse. Automatically release numbers after the defined window.
  • Access governance: Apply least-privilege access, rotate API keys regularly, and implement IP-based allowlists. Use separate keys for production, staging, and QA environments.
  • Monitoring and anomaly detection: Enable anomaly detection on verification patterns, such as bursts of OTP requests, to detect potential abuse or fraud.
  • Compliance and data sovereignty: Ensure your use of temporary numbers adheres to local laws, including data residency requirements in markets like Vietnam and Europe.
  • Auditability: Maintain auditable logs of number allocations, message events, and TTL expirations to support internal reviews and regulatory inquiries.
  • Testing hygiene: In development environments, rely on non-operational test strings (for example, british airways 1604) to validate logic without impacting live users. Move to production data only after clearance.

These precautions are not optional add-ons; they are integral to a responsible, scalable verification program. When combined with robust technical controls, they enable enterprises to pursue aggressive growth while maintaining trust with customers and regulators.

Operational best practices for integration

To maximize value, integrate the temporary-number service with your existing ecosystems in a disciplined manner. Here are recommended best practices that align with a business-first mindset:

  • API-first mindset: Build idempotent flows, handle retries gracefully, and ensure you can recover from partial failures without data loss.
  • Metrics-driven evolution: Track key performance indicators such as provisioning time, OTP delivery latency, and TTL utilization to continuously optimize your flows.
  • Compliance by design: Embed privacy-by-design principles in every step—from data handling to retention policies and user communications.
  • Localized routing: For markets like Vietnam, optimize routing to reduce latency and improve deliverability, taking into account local carriers and regulatory considerations.
  • Fraud risk controls: Combine temporary numbers with device fingerprinting, IP reputation checks, and behavioral analytics to strengthen verification results.
